What is a Scae? A scae in Byzantine music is typicay composed of eight notes. The steps between notes can be of varying degrees: semitone, whoe tone, toneahaf. Each scae is composed of two tetrachords separated by a whoe tone. A tetrachord is a scae of four notes, with first ast note of tetrachord being in interva of a fourth. The Western Maor Scae is an exampe of a famiiar scae comprised of two tetrachords separated by a whoe tone: The Maor Scae What is a Chromatic scae? In Byzantine music, defining characteristic of a Chromatic scae is that tetrachords are made up of foowing three intervas: semitone, toneahaf, semitone (short, wide, short): Chromatic Scae based on The Chromatic scae can be derived from Maor scae by fatting 2 nd 6 th notes. The wide intervas of a toneahaf give this scae an Eastern or Midde Eastern quaity not found in Western music.
